Over the years, edward gorey collected twentyone fur coats, which he was notorious for wearing with converse sneakers, often to the new york city ballet. John gorey, author and artist and master of the macabre, was born ordinarily enough on february 22, 1925 in chicago, illinois, the son of edward leo gorey, a newspaperman, and helen dunham garvey gorey, a government clerk. While working in the anchordoubleday art department in the 1950s, the illustrator and writer edward gorey discovered a longforgotten cache of material by an earlier artist, the krazy kat creator george herriman.
